Spoon Dolls!

I've made some new friends and I'd like to share them with you. Spoon dolls are a long-standing folk art tradition. These babies (most are of drinking age, actually) are painted onto recycled wooden spoons. Won't you open your heart and home to a new pal (or two)?

Left to Right: Phillip, Vera, Reina, Binky and Bridgett. $20 each (plus shipping, if applicable)

Call to Artists: Red & White



Call to Artists:
Pom Pom’s Teahouse and Sandwicheria, St. Pete, Fl invites local artists to submit entries for its upcoming exhibit Red & White. 
The show will feature works executed within the theme of the title colors. Half (or better) of each entry should be executed in red, white or a combination of the two. 
You may submit up to 4 images (at least 500x500 and no larger than 1000x1000 pixels) of available works.
Each entry should measure no smaller than 6" x 6" and no larger than 30” x 40”. All work must be wired and ready to hang upon delivery (no sawtooth hangers please).
Red & White will run from December 14th through February 14th. An artist reception date for the show will be announced shortly. 
Commission split is 25%, with 75% to the artist.
Please submit images along with Title/Medium/Size info for each to: jgascot@gascot.com
Submission deadline: Monday, December 7. 
Acceptance emails will be sent by Wednesday, December 9.
All accepted works must be delivered on Sunday, December 13, 6:00 pm.
